What is the used car price of the Porsche Cayenne Turbo?

The cheapest Porsche Cayenne Turbo that is available here on AutoUncle costs £6,995, while the most expensive model is priced at £69,800.

The used car price of an Porsche Cayenne Turbo is determined by a number of factors, the most important of which are production year, engine capacity and performance, fuel consumption of the car, how much the car's odometer reads and equipment.

For example, a newer model with fewer miles recorded, or a more luxurious variant with a powerful engine, typically commands a higher price than, for example, an older model with more kilometres driven or with a lower equipment level.

What kind of car is the Porsche Cayenne Turbo?

The Porsche Cayenne Turbo is only available in the SUV body type in the UK. SUV stands for Sport Utility Vehicle and represents one of the most sought-after car types in today's market. These vehicles are known for their versatility and elevated driving position, attributes that are particularly favoured by many motorists.
